Text For Citation: 03 Item/Group: 002 Hazard:
29 CFR 1926.451(b)(5)(ii): The end of a platform greater than 10 feet in length extended over its support more than 18 inches and the platform was not designed and installed so that the cantilevered portion of the platform is able to support employees without tipping, or has guardrails which block employee access to the cantilevered end: Location: 45 Highland Ave Lowell MA On or about October 5, 2016, the end of the ladder jack scaffold extended more than 18 inches over the support. Luis Quindi dba Speedy Gonsales was previously cited for a violation of this occupational safety and health standard 1926.452(b)(5)(ii), which was contained in OSHA inspection number 992151, citation number 3, item number 1 and was affirmed as a final order on October 24, 2014, with respect to a workplace located at Newell Meadow Condominiums, Chester Rd., Derry, NH 03038. This violation was most recently observed on October 5, 2016 at a jobsite located at 45 Highland Ave, Lowell, MA 01851 where the platform of the ladder jack scaffold extended more than 18 inches over the support. To abate this violation, the employer must ensure that the platforms of ladder jack scaffolds are not more than 18 inches over the support.
